What You'll Do : As a Casualty Claims Representative, you will investigate, evaluate, negotiate and settle assigned claims involving casualty insurance coverage. In this opportunity, you will typically handle auto liability investigation and bodily injury claims. You must investigate the facts of the loss, interpret the policy, and determine whether the loss is covered and if our client member is liable. You will also determine the value of the loss and assist in setting appropriate reserves. In this role, it is very important to have a strong knowledge of tort law and how it relates to specific cases. As a Casualty Claims Representative, you must keep a service-oriented attitude at all times by maintaining professional and productive relationships with coworkers, supervisors, agents, agency managers, claimants, policyholders, doctors, attorneys, and others.
